## v2.4.0 — TilePiper Prefetcher

- Prefetch radius now adaptive to pan velocity.
- Dropped zoom-level 19 from the warm cache; hit rate didn't justify the storage.
- Fixed duplicate fetches on viewport rotation.
- Config key renamed; old key logs a warning until v2.6.

For design rationale or emergency cache flushes, contact the subsystem owner.

named custodian: Belius Casath Ulaix Sorius

**Onboarding: Leafhaus Drift Watch**

For the weekly sync: the Leafhaus greenhouse controller shows humidity sensor drift after ~40 days uptime. Mitigation is the drift-correction daemon, `leafcal`, which recalibrates against the reference probe nightly. If drift exceeds 4%, it pages the on-call. To run `leafcal` locally against the Bramwick test greenhouse, copy `env.example` to `.env` and set `LEAFCAL_SITE=bramwick`. The daemon also needs the telemetry write token; append it on the following line:

env line for kaguf-hahop: COURIER_KEY29=2e2fa9479f98362396e2c28f86fc9

**Action item (INC follow-up): Varrow Assign service**

Sticky assignments expired early during the outage, so some users flipped experiment arms mid-session. Support: if customers report inconsistent features, check assignment timestamps before escalating. Fix shipped; TTLs and cache bounds were retuned to prevent recurrence. Do not manually reassign users. Escalate only if flips persist past the new TTL window. Revised constants are listed below.

tuning table, yaweg-kajef:
WEIGHTS = {
    "ralwyn": 573,
    "praius": 56,
    "eliok": 19,
}

## Changelog — Font vendoring defaults changed

As of this release, the Bracken UI build no longer fetches third-party fonts at build time. All typefaces used by the Lanternwell suite are now vendored into the repo under a dedicated assets directory, and the fetch step is skipped by default. If you're onboarding, nothing to install — the fonts travel with the checkout. The build flags controlling this behavior are listed below.

settings of hadup-yafog:
LAMAEL_PIN=3761
LAMAEL_TENANT=istmir
LAMAEL_METRICS_HOST=metrics.lamael.plorvasys.test
LAMAEL_SEAL=seal_8ea68500
LAMAEL_STANDBY_TEAM=fraok